Pressure-Reducing Valves: A Comprehensive Guide

Pressure-reducing devices are essential components in fluid systems, built to safely lower elevated inlet pressure to a predetermined outlet head . These devices safeguard equipment and installations from destruction caused by over- pressure, while also ensuring a consistent downstream head .

Considerations when specifying a pressure-reducing regulator include the inlet force range, outlet force requirement, fluid capacity, and the kind of substance being handled. Here's a quick look:

  • Types: Direct-acting, Pilot-operated
  • Materials: Stainless steel, Brass, Bronze
  • Applications: Residential water systems, Industrial processes, Irrigation

Proper setup and maintenance are crucial to maximum performance and lifespan of these valves .

Water Pressure Regulator Problems & Solutions

Dealing with fluctuating water pressure can be a real headache, and often the cause is a malfunctioning plumbing regulator. These units are designed to maintain a consistent level of pressure, protecting your get more info appliances from damage, but they can encounter issues. Common problems include excessively high pressure , low pressure , seepage, or complete failure . Possible solutions range from simple calibrations – often requiring a particular wrench to modify the regulator's setting – to replacing the entire unit. Sometimes, sediment build-up inside the regulator can hinder performance ; cleaning the regulator might resolve this. If these steps don't succeed the problem , it's best to consult a qualified technician to diagnose and repair the situation .
